The electric operating table has long been a staple in operating rooms, providing surgeons with the ability to adjust the patient's position with ease. However, the latest generation of these tables comes equipped with a host of cutting-edge features that are revolutionizing surgical procedures. One of the most notable advancements is the integration of highly precise positioning systems. These systems allow for minute adjustments, enabling surgeons to position patients with an accuracy that was previously unimaginable. This level of precision is crucial for complex surgeries, such as neurosurgery and orthopedic procedures, where even the slightest deviation can have significant consequences.

The safety aspects of the upgraded electric operating tables are also a major draw for hospitals. These tables are equipped with advanced sensors and monitoring systems that continuously track the patient's position and vital signs. In the event of any anomaly, the system can immediately alert the surgical team, allowing for quick intervention. This not only reduces the risk of complications during surgery but also provides an added layer of protection for patients.

Moreover, the ergonomic design of the new electric operating tables is a significant improvement. Surgeons and surgical staff can operate the tables with greater ease and comfort, reducing fatigue during long and complex procedures. This not only enhances the efficiency of the surgical team but also contributes to better outcomes for patients.

However, the adoption of this technology is not without its challenges. The high cost of the upgraded electric operating tables is a significant barrier for some hospitals, particularly in smaller or resource-limited settings. Additionally, there is a need for comprehensive training for surgical staff to ensure they can fully utilize the features of the new tables.
